    It's chafing gear, used on the bottom of seine nets. I make a backstop about 12' in length, in order to stop the rounds or " cookies" after one can no longer rig. It works well, stopping 300+ pound rounds from rolling down into structures. Go to any fishing supply store, it can be had for about...
